Full of image examples, hands-on assignments, and proven techniques, this book will show you how to expand your vision and take your photography to the next level., Learn how light can breathe new life into your photos Do you take too many snapshots and not enough "wow" shots? If so, you may be spending more time thinking about your subjects than thinking about the light. In "The BetterPhoto Guide to Light, " veteran photography instructors Jim Miotke and Kerry Drager help amateur shooters of all levels master this basic ingredient of compelling photography. You'll learn how to identify the best light, fix common lighting problems, and, most important, take stunning photos with whatever light you have. Full of image examples, hands-on assignments, and proven techniques, this book will show you how to expand your vision and take your photography to the next level.
